Jacobacci & Partners (Italy) says: "Clarifying previous case law, the Supreme Court has stated that when two semi-identical European and Italian patents exist for the same invention and the European patent is rejected by a final decision, Italian courts are free to ignore the European decisions and conclude that the Italian patent remains valid under Italian law."

Here, as one example, is a press release from yesterday (Wednesday):

IRLAB announced today that drug candidates IRL942 and IRL1009 have been granted composition of matter patents in the US and Europe from respective authorities. The preclinical drug candidates are currently undergoing preparatory steps to meet the regulatory requirements for obtaining permission to conduct clinical phase I studies. Securing the intellectual property rights is an important step in protecting the results of the company's research and strengthens the projects' position and commercial potential.

Drug candidates IRL942 and IRL1009 stem from IRLAB's P001 research program and are derived from the proprietary research platform ISP. IRL942 and IRL1009 are intended for treatment of mental and cognitive decline as well as declining motor skills linked to neurodegenerative diseases and ageing. In several recently conducted preclinical studies, the drug candidates' show increased nerve cell signaling and improved cognition in behavioral studies.


Here are a few copies of the other paid-for press release from Wednesday [1, 2]:

Compugen Ltd. (CGEN), a clinical-stage cancer immunotherapy company and leader in predictive target discovery, announced today that The European Patent Office (EPO) has granted a new patent covering the composition of matter and use of COM902, its immuno-oncology therapeutic antibody targeting TIGIT.

EPO Patent No. EP3347379, titled "Anti-TIGIT antibodies, anti-PVRIG antibodies and combinations thereof," relates to the composition of matter of COM902, alone or in combination with a second antibody targeting an immune checkpoint, including PD-1 and PVRIG (specifically COM701). The patent further relates to COM902 for use in treating cancer by activating T cells, a key driver of immune stimulation and cancer immunotherapy treatments.


This patent, EP3347379, has not been tested in an actual court and examiners themselves berate the quality of the work, rightly blaming it on pressure, lack of time and 'production' targets.
